  • Rent-A-Center reports stable Q1 profit

    Plano, Texas – Rent-A-Center Inc. reported stable profit during the first quarter of fiscal 2015. The retailer’s net income totaled $27.3 million, up 1% from $27.26 million in the same quarter a year earlier.

    Consolidated total revenues climbed 6% to $877.64 million, from $828.47 million. Same-store sales rose 8%.

  • H&M makes EPA green power lists

    New York - H&M is number 32 on the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ency's (EPA's) National Top 100 list of the largest green power users. H&M is using nearly 172 million kilowatt-hours (kWh) of green power annually, which is enough green power to meet 100% of the organization's electricity use.

  • Retailers doing good: Ann Inc. donates millions to cancer research; Whole Foods fights against poverty

    New York -- High-profile retailers can make a high-impact difference when they use their clout to do good.  

    Case in point: Ann Inc., parent to Ann Taylor and Loft, donated more than $4.3 million to the Breast Cancer Research Foundation to fund groundbreaking cancer research. The brands parlayed successes from the 2014 spring and fall campaigns and have brought the company's total corporate donation to $22.3 million in the past 10 years.

  • Dell: POS, encrypted malware attacks surge in 2014

    Round Rock, Texas – Retailers experienced substantial increases in POS malware attacks and also an increase in malware traffic contained within encrypted Web protocols. According to the Dell Annual Threat Report, which leverages research from Dell’s Global Response Intelligence Defense (GRID) network and telemetry data from Dell SonicWall network traffic, the Dell SonicWall Threat Research Team created 13 POS malware signatures in 2014.
